Diamond particles were 1.3 million years ago in North America by the devastating impact the comet
British “Daily Mail” reported that a few days ago, scientists claimed that the North American soil to confirm the existence of diamond particles on Earth 1.3 million years ago with the burning comet collision, the collision resulted in the demise of early humans in North America.Based on the controversial research, the comet collision has also led to the extinction of dozens of animals, such as: Mammoth, so that 1.3 million years ago the ice age in the global scope of the extension. However, North America early human civilizations of Clovis (Clovis culture) in the comet collision incident will vanish completely.
These diamonds are very small particles, only in the electron microscope can be visible to the naked eye. It is learned that these nano-diamond particles exist in North America a few feet underground, in which a mining location in the United States, AZ Murray Springs Clovis civilization ruins region. The researchers said that this kind of diamond particles formed in a cosmic explosion, in a state of high temperature and high pressure formed.
The researchers found that 1.3 million years ago, a rare “honeycomb” comet crashed into the North American continent, the melting of the North American Great Lakes region has been covered by glaciers, forming a huge flow of the Mississippi River floods. The collision between the comet formed a huge water waves of the Atlantic have had a significant impact on the emergence of ice age the famous “Younger Dryas event” (Younger Dryas). Once again makes the expansion of glaciers, sea level dropped again.
The collision between the comet 0.65 billion years ago suggests that a huge comet collision could lead to the disappearance of the dinosaurs on Earth. The study co-author of one of the authors of the report of the geophysicist Allen West said: “We can imagine these fireball exploded in the air. Clovis hunters stand hilltop surprised to see these fireballs appear out of the blue, when the These fireballs will fall on the ground and exploded, unable to resist the formation of a shock wave, obliterated by 1.3 million years ago the ancient life in North America. This explosion is likely to be silent, but it is a spectacular explosion, the release of a dazzling light, or even than the sun still bright. ”
West in the “Washington Post” reporter said: “The comet collision in North America will have a radiant heat, this strong radiant heat will burn at least animal’s body, severe cases of animal will be reduced to ashes. This times the comet collision led to the extinction of North America, 35 kinds of mammals, such as: mammoth, mastodon, saber-toothed tiger, and lazy, the Inter-American camels, short-face bear, giant beaver and the Americas, such as lions. ”
The project was led by Oregon State University, University of California, Northern Arizona University, Oklahoma De Paul University and the University of archaeologists and geologists completed common. The study, published in the January 3 issue of “Nature” magazine. University of Oregon archaeologist Douglas Kennett, said: “The latest study found a strong 12.9 million years ago confirmed the comet collision incident, the disaster led to North America early humans, plants and animals disappear.”
However, some criticism that the formation of the comet collision on Earth in North America there is insufficient evidence of climate change, they said such a collision of the comet will be on the ground to form some type of crater.
